There are basically three things that you need to focus while playing golf. Once you master the three requirements of the game, you can definitely become a good golfer. Following are the vital factors that you must consider:
Aim
You must keep your aim/target very focused. Golf is all about target and aiming. Even a right stroke or perfect swing aligned incorrectly can send the ball towards the wrong direction, thereby missing the aimed hole. Hence, to avoid this swing based alignment drawback, it is always better to align feet, knees, hips and shoulders parallel left to the target line. This tactic is followed by many elite and successful golfers.
Stance
The stance is the very foundation for the correct swing. For an effective swing you need mobility and stability. The stance would differ depending upon the length of the club. If you have a longer club, shoulder width stance is good. You can measure this from the outside of the shoulder down to the in step. For short irons, hip width stance is better. You can measure this from the outside of the hips to the instep. Stance width is very important for maintaining a stable base and good swing.
Ball position
Ball positioning is another important factor that you must pay attention to. Ball positioning is placement of the golf ball in relation to the position of your feet. Positioning the golf ball correctly in your stance is vital for a great shot. Beginners must start by learning where the ball is in relation to their feet and also how far away the ball is from the feet. The ball placement varies with the size of the club you select.
